Vasily Sokolovsky

Vasily Danilovich Sokolovsky (Russian: Васи́лий Дани́лович Соколо́вский) (July 21, 1897 - May 10, 1968), Soviet military commander, was born into a peasant family in Kozliki, a small town in the province of Grodno, near Białystok in Poland (then part of the Russian Empire).
